Title Intention to Use Smart City System Based on Social Cognitive Theory
Year 2016
Published
Abstract Through a mobile application to respond citizen's grievance/complain, called QLUE, the government of Jakarta, Indonesia, begins to implement smart city concepts. However, QLUE usage and adoption level is still low compared to the number of population. Therefore, this study examined the determinants of citizen's behavioral intention to use smart city system (QLUE) based on the extended social cognitive theory (SeT) model. Data collection was conducted using questionnaire to QLUE users. The adopted model was examined using PartialLeast Square (PLS). The results showed that behavioral intention to use QLUE is positively influenced by affect and social influence. On other hand, the negative relationship between anxiety and behavioral intention is not supported in this study. Limitations and implications of the study are also presented.
